Preferred Networks (PFN) has launched its flagship domestic large language model, PLaMo 3.0 Prime, on Sakura Internet's AI inference API platform, Sakura's AI Engine, starting August 4. The deployment marks the first availability of PFN's full-scratch reasoning model through a Japanese cloud provider's API, with access granted on an application basis (free tier excluded). The model, based on pre-training research with NICT, extends context length from 64k to 256k tokens, enhances Japanese language performance, and claims competitive results in instruction following, coding, and tool use against open models like Qwen3.6-27B and closed models like GPT-5.4 mini and Claude Haiku 4.5. Pricing is disclosed only to approved users.
This partnership underscores a strategic move by PFN to distribute its models through domestic cloud infrastructure, capitalizing on Japan's push for sovereign AI capabilities. By leveraging Sakura's high-performance data centers, PFN gains a distribution channel that appeals to enterprises prioritizing data residency and regulatory compliance. For the broader market, PLaMo 3.0 Prime's availability on an API platform lowers the barrier for Japanese enterprises to adopt a locally developed, reasoning-capable LLM, potentially accelerating AI integration in sectors like finance and government where data sovereignty is critical. It also intensifies competition among Japanese cloud providers to host preferred domestic models, aligning with national interests in technological self-reliance.
For builders, this means access to a frontier-scale reasoning model with strong Japanese-language support and extended context, ideal for agentic workflows and complex document processing. However, the application-only access and non-public pricing could create friction for rapid prototyping. Investors should view this as a signal of PFN's go-to-market maturation, moving from research to productized distribution via strategic partnerships—a pattern that may increase PFN's enterprise traction and valuation potential. The success of this deployment could set a precedent for other domestic AI labs to partner with local cloud providers, reshaping the Japanese AI infrastructure landscape.
